    Story

    Our dear Heather tragically passed away on 2nd November 2020. Her funeral took place on Friday 4th December at 12.00 at Saltwell Crematorium, Gateshead.

    In lieu of flowers, we have set up this page for anyone who may wish to make a donation in Heather's memory.

    Ideally, we would like to purchase a memorial bench (£2,000), to be installed somewhere she loved along the Firth of Forth near Edinburgh with views out across the estuary. We know Heather would appreciate the practicality of this too, as someone with limited mobility herself.

    We would also like to plant or adopt a tree through Tree Time Edinburgh (£500) https://www.tree-time.com/

    We will donate any additional funds to charities that we believe Heather would want us to support - Edinburgh Dog & Cat Home and SustransUK. We are in the process of setting up a separate Justgiving page for the charities so that they can claim 25% GiftAid on eligible donations: https://www.justgiving.com/team/heather-stronach

    For Heather's family and friends in New Zealand, we plan to set up a separate fundraiser for you guys - watch this space!

    Please rest assured too that we intend to arrange further celebration events for Heather in the UK, New Zealand and Germany when restrictions are lifted.

      Hello everyone, I'm so pleased to let you know that Heather's memorial bench has now been installed in a beautiful spot at Musselburgh Lagoons near Edinburgh. The bench overlooks a lake opposite a nature reserve that is renowned for its birdlife. The bench includes some personal touches – a purple rose, to celebrate her favourite colour and her favourite band (Guns ‘n’ Roses), a Kiwi, to represent her connections to New Zealand, and two Canada Geese, which she loved to hear flying in formation over her home in nearby Musselburgh.
